Early Relaxation Dynamics in the Photoswitchable Complex trans‐[RuCl(NO)(py)4]2+

The design of photoswitchable transition metal complexes with tailored properties is one of the most important challenges in chemistry.S tudies explaining the underlying mechanismsa re, however,s carce. Herein, the early relaxation dynamics towards NO photoisomerization in trans-[RuCl(NO)(py) 4 ] 2 + is elucidated by meanso fn on-adiabatic dynamics, which provided time-resolved information and branching ratios. Three deactivation mechanisms(I, II, III) in the ratio 3:2:4w ere identified. Pathways Ia nd III involve ul-trafast intersystem crossinga nd internal conversion, whereas pathway II involves only internal conversion.
